Market Chatter: Hong Kong's Home Sales Value Jumps 17% in February

Hong Kong's home sales value totaled HK$57.6 billion in February, up 17% from January and 150.3% year-on-year, The Standard reported Tuesday, citing the Land Registry.

The number of residential sale and purchase agreements reached 6,669, rising 17.6% from the previous month and 108.4% from a year earlier, according to the report.

Across all building units, the Land Registry recorded 7,924 sale and purchase agreements received for registration in February, up 3.8% month-on-month and 84% year-on-year, the report said.

Total consideration for these agreements amounted to HK$62.1 billion, increasing 8.6% from January and 119.7% from the same period last year, the report added.
